#4b0e80 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4b0e80 is composed of 29.4% red, 5.5%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.4% cyan, 89.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 272.1 degrees, a saturation of 80.3% and a lightness of 27.8%. #4b0e80 color hex could be obtained by blending #961cff with #000001.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#4b0e80 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4b0e80 has RGB values of R:75, G:14,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0.89, Y:0,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 4918912.
